Abstract

A controller of a storage device having a user area storing an operating system, the storage device developing the operating system stored in the user area on a host device in accordance with an access from the host device. The controller includes a user authentication routine storage controlling unit that stores a user authentication routine for executing user authentication before startup of the operating system, in a predetermined area inside the user area, and an access controlling unit that permits access to the predetermined area from the host device when the user authentication routine is used, while prohibiting access to the predetermined area from the host device when the user authentication routine is not used.
